Local 727 Secures Retroactivity Agreement for all Trade Show Industry Members

| December 21, 2018

While Teamsters Local 727, Freeman Decorating Company, and Global Exposition Services (G.E.S.) have made significant progress during negotiations for new trade show industry collective bargaining agreements, the issue of the Central States Pension Fund has not yet been completely decided.  As such, negotiations for a new master trade show industry, Freeman warehouse, and G.E.S. warehouse contracts will continue into the new year.

As the trade show industry CBA’s are set to expire on December 31, 2018, Local 727 has secured a Retroactivity Agreement with Freeman and G.E.S. which ensures Local 727 members will receive all wage raises agreed upon in the future contracts retroactive to January 1, 2019.

“Local 727 will not stop fighting for our members,” said John Coli, Jr., Secretary-Treasurer of Local 727.  “We won’t give-in and we won’t give-up until we secure contracts that our members can depend upon.”

Local 727 will continue to keep members updated on the progress of negotiations in 2019.
